是指在Firebase平台上定义和配置的访问控制规则,用于控制对Firebase数据库和存储的访问权限。Firebase是一种移动和Web应用程序开发平台,提供了一系列的云服务,包括实时数据库、身份验证、云存储、云函数等。
Firebase规则使用一种类似于JSON的语法来定义,可以根据特定的条件和规则来限制对数据的读写操作。这些规则可以基于用户的身份、数据的结构和内容等进行配置,以确保数据的安全性和完整性。
特定的Firebase规则具有以下特点和优势:
- 灵活性:Firebase规则可以根据应用程序的需求进行定制,可以定义复杂的条件和规则来满足不同的访问需求。
- 安全性:通过Firebase规则,可以限制对敏感数据的访问权限,确保只有经过授权的用户才能访问。
- 实时更新:Firebase规则可以实时更新,即时反映对数据访问权限的更改,保证数据的安全性和一致性。
- 简化开发:通过使用Firebase规则,开发人员可以简化对数据访问权限的管理和控制,减少开发工作量。
特定的Firebase规则可以应用于各种场景,例如:
- 用户身份验证:可以使用规则限制只有经过身份验证的用户才能访问特定的数据。
- 数据完整性:可以使用规则验证数据的结构和内容,确保数据的完整性和一致性。
- 数据权限控制:可以使用规则限制不同用户对数据的访问权限,例如只允许管理员进行写操作。
- 实时更新:可以使用规则实时更新数据的访问权限,以反映对用户权限的更改。
腾讯云提供了类似的云服务,可以用于实现类似的功能。腾讯云的云数据库CDB、云存储COS、云函数SCF等产品可以与Firebase相对应,提供类似的功能和服务。具体产品介绍和文档可以参考以下链接:
- 腾讯云数据库CDB:https://cloud.tencent.com/product/cdb
- 腾讯云云存储COS:https://cloud.tencent.com/product/cos
- 腾讯云云函数SCF:https://cloud.tencent.com/product/scf